National Occupational Exposure Survey
(1981 - 1983)

Estimated Numbers of Employees Potentially Exposed to Specific Agents by Occupation*

Agent Name CHLORINE OXIDE (CLO2)
CAS # 10049-04-4
RTECS # FO3000000
Agent Code 18045

Code Occupation Description (1980) Total # Employees
(Male & Female)
Total # Female
Employees
056 INDUSTRIAL ENGINEERS 30  
095 REGISTERED NURSES 1,047 1,022
216 ENGINEERING TECHNICIANS, N.E.C. 32  
449 MAIDS AND HOUSEMEN 2,404 1,596
453 JANITORS AND CLEANERS 3,273 1,731
519 MACHINERY MAINTENANCE OCCUPATIONS 3  
585 PLUMBERS, PIPEFITTERS, AND STEAMFITTERS 8  
764 WASHING, CLEANING, AND PICKLING MACHINE OPERATORS 911  
777 MISCELLANEOUS MACHINE OPERATORS, N.E.C. 95  
779 MACHINE OPERATORS, NOT SPECIFIED 8  
783 WELDERS AND CUTTERS 5  
883 FREIGHT, STOCK, AND MATERIAL MOVERS, HAND, N.E.C. 76  
TOTAL 7,892 4,348

*(1) The estimates for each occupation apply across the surveyed industries in which the agent was observed. Not all industries were surveyed, and not all agents were observed in all surveyed industries. (2) When using the estimates, standard errors associated with estimates should be considered. (3) Potential exposures to a chemical agent are categorized as actual (i.e., the surveyor observed the use of the specific agent) or tradename (i.e., the surveyor observed the use of a tradename product known to contain the specific agent). The estimates presented in the table combine both categories.
